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

SalonTarget

  • Pricing is not published; costs come through a demo or trial

Salon Iris

  • saloniris.com/pricing returns a 301 redirect to daysmart.com/salon/pricing; the product is sold as DaySmart Salon
  • The $29 per month entry plan includes only 1 user and excludes resource management, packages, memberships, payroll and digital forms
  • Additional users cost $9 per month each
  • Text and email volumes are capped per plan, starting at 500 texts and 1,000 emails per month
  • Text marketing, two way texting, reputation management and the website builder are separately priced add ons
